Telehealth ROCKS Together

Focus:

Training, telementoring, and support to families, schools, and communities on the topics of pediatric care and behavioral health. 

About:

Telehealth ROCKS Together connects specialists at academic medical centers with providers across the state of Kansas. We provide evidence-based training and facilitate learning community models of professional education and support. Our telementoring focus includes clinicians in clinical and school settings (school counselors, therapists, psychologists, teachers). 

Funding:

This program is funded by HRSA through the Telehealth Technology‐Enabled Learning Program Grant # U3I43512. 

Components:

Echos

Telementoring

Other distance/virtual training modalities (website, videos, etc.)

Goals:

  • To engage diverse community stakeholders to tailor, implement, and evaluate a menu of telementoring opportunities to enhance pediatric health and behavioral health. 
  • Increase training and collaboration with multidisciplinary specialists across the three-tier model of pediatric health and behavioral health intervention. 
  • Advance validated measures and strategic evaluation. 
  • To support diverse trainee participation in Telehealth ROCKS Together telementoring activities. 
  • Provide ongoing well-being and resilience telementoring and resources.
